Dubai Municipality reported that it is implementing an integrated work system and an emergency plan that enables it to face locusts and agricultural pests at any time, stressing that the situation is currently stable and there are no locusts in the emirate.

The municipality assured «Emirates Today» that it has a system of precise procedures and an approved plan to deal with the spread of agricultural pests, which, during the recent period, immediately after locusts gathering locusts in several regions, they confronted them by allocating control teams to deal with and follow them, and to respond to inquiries The public about it, and it turns out that these swarms are mobile, and have settled in the city of Dubai only in some few areas, and they were combated over three days to make sure they are eliminated, and conducting several surveys and exploration to ensure that there are no parts of these swarms in some areas.

Dubai Municipality denied the information that was circulated recently, and videos warning community members of the spread of locusts in areas of Dubai, stressing that what was circulated is old, dating back to the date of 24 of last month, and that the Emirate of Dubai is currently free of locust gatherings.

She stressed that the situation is currently stable, and there are no swarms of locusts currently in the Emirate of Dubai, and called upon all members of society when seeing such cases to locate the locust gathering, and direct reporting through the call center on the number «800900», and the municipality will move urgently to the site and deal with the situation According to the procedures followed, and stressed the need not to circulate such sections that cause fear among members of society, and to return to the Dubai Municipality when you need to inquire about these phenomena.

Recently, videos showing desert locusts flying heavily on the roads and in the skies of some areas, accompanied by a warning to members of society, including demanding to close windows and doors and not open them, and identified areas such as Al Barsha, Palm Jumeirah, and Dubai Marina, and after reviewing these sections it turned out to be old On May 24, one of them was in the Dubai Marina area, where the city of Dubai was exposed to the passage of a number of moving desert locusts, as a result of the emirate's exposure to active southeastern winds, which helped the desert locust move from the breeding areas in the eastern Arabian Gulf and its passage in the Emirate of Dubai.
